Research Focus and Impact

Dr. Akhayere’s research spans several critical areas within environmental science, including nanotechnology, toxicology, agricultural and solid waste management, nanomaterials, water treatment, and material chemistry. His work is especially notable for its application of nanotechnology to environmental challenges. One of his key contributions is the development of nanomaterials—such as nanosilica and nanozeolite—from agricultural by-products like barley grass straw, which are then used in practical applications like water purification and removal of petrol contaminants from water. These environmentally sustainable solutions have the potential to address both global water shortages and industrial pollution problems.

Publications

Dr. Akhayere has authored numerous articles in high-impact, peer-reviewed international journals. Some of his standout publications include:

  1. Effective and reusable nano-silica synthesized from barley and wheat grass for the removal of nickel from agricultural wastewater.
  2. Nano-silica and nano-zeolite synthesized from barley grass straw for effective removal of gasoline from aqueous solution.
  3. Thermal performance analysis of a parabolic trough collector using water-based green-synthesized nanofluids.

His research not only demonstrates academic rigor but also emphasizes real-world applications, bridging the gap between cutting-edge science and environmental sustainability.

Projects

One of Dr. Akhayere’s most notable projects is the Removal of Petrol Contaminants from Water Using Synthesized Nano Silica, which underscores his expertise in nanotechnology and water treatment. This project exemplifies his approach to tackling environmental challenges by using green-synthesized nanomaterials to create effective, low-cost solutions for water purification.

Award-Winning Work in Nanotechnology

In July 2024, Dr. Akhayere was awarded the prestigious Top Researcher Award in Nanotechnology. This highly coveted honor recognized his innovative research and groundbreaking contributions to the field of nanotechnology, particularly for his work on synthesizing eco-friendly nanomaterials for environmental applications. The award ceremony, held at Cyprus International University, celebrated his outstanding achievements and the positive global impact of his work.

Receiving this award solidified Dr Akhayere’s status as a leading figure in nanotechnology, not only within Cyprus but on a global scale.
